Understanding Affiliate Marketing
Affiliate marketing is a performance-based marketing strategy where an individual, known as the affiliate, earns a commission by promoting someone else’s products or services. This system functions on a simple premise: affiliates partner with businesses to market their offerings, driving traffic and potential sales back to the business’s website. The affiliate receives a unique identifier, such as a tracking link, which allows the company to track conversions and reward the affiliate accordingly.
There are various types of affiliate programs available, including pay-per-sale (PPS), pay-per-click (PPC), and pay-per-lead (PPL). In a pay-per-sale model, affiliates earn a commission when a purchaser buys a product through their referral link. Conversely, pay-per-click provides remuneration for generating clicks to the merchant’s website, regardless of whether a sale occurs. Pay-per-lead is slightly different, incentivizing affiliates based on the generation of leads that may result in future sales.

Building Your Affiliate Product Promotion Website
Establishing a dedicated website for promoting affiliate products is a crucial step in executing a successful online sales strategy. The first consideration when embarking on this journey is selecting the right domain name. A domain that is relevant to your niche can significantly enhance your site’s credibility and attractiveness. Aim for a name that is concise, memorable, and reflects your brand identity. Once you have a domain, the next step is to choose a reliable hosting provider that offers excellent uptime, speed, and responsive customer support, ensuring that your website operates smoothly for all visitors.
Next, the design of your website plays a pivotal role in user experience. Opt for a clean, user-friendly layout that enhances navigation. Incorporate intuitive menus and a search function to help visitors find products easily. Additionally, responsive design is vital, as a significant portion of users access websites via mobile devices. Incorporating high-quality images, clear product descriptions, and well-structured content will keep users engaged and encourage potential buyers to explore your offerings.
To attract visitors, implementing effective content marketing techniques is essential. Begin by conducting keyword research to identify terms that your target audience is searching for. This strategy will enhance your Search Engine Optimization (SEO) efforts and improve your site’s visibility on search engines. Regularly publishing high-quality content such as blog posts, product reviews, and how-to guides will not only help in attracting organic traffic but also establish you as a trusted authority in your niche. Utilization of social media platforms to share your content can further amplify your reach and drive traffic to your website.
